Popular places to visit
Naritasan Shinshoji Temple
Explore a 1,000-year-old Buddhist temple complex and attend a fire ritual performed in honor of an important Buddhist deity.
Narita Omotesando
Winding through the city, this street offers a glimpse and taste of old Japan, from temples and gardens to zodiac sculptures and freshwater eel dishes.
Narita Wholesale Market
Watch the tuna auction and cutting before the sun comes up and explore the selection of rare and unusual fish available from the stalls.
Taiheiyo Club Narita Course
With a majestic clubhouse and stunning topography of ponds, forests and leafy hills, this golf center has an exclusive and glamorous atmosphere.
Sakura-no-Yama Hill
Explore the great outdoors at Sakura-no-Yama Hill, a lovely green space in Narita. Add the area's shops or temples to your travel plans.
Naritasan Park
Delight in the bright colors of cherry blossom trees that surround the lakes, shrines and paths of this picturesque park.
Narita Tourist Pavilion
As the epicenter of activity on the iconic Narita Omotesando street, this elegant museum serves a tea ceremony and teaches visitors about the area.
Naritasan Calligraphy Museum
Find out how Japanese handwriting has evolved over the centuries via the many works of calligraphy and rubbings and short films on the art form.
Narita Yokan Museum
Have a fun and informative visit in this two-story museum, exploring the origins of NAGOMI-YONEYA, one of Japan’s most iconic dessert brands.
